Latest Patents
Mark Petersen holds a patent for a "Lug closure for press-on application to, and rotational removal from, a container." This invention features a closure designed for easy application and removal from containers with cylindrical necks. The closure includes a flexible cylindrical skirt made from polyolefin, such as polypropylene, and features radially inwardly projecting lugs that engage with helical threads on the container neck. This design allows for a secure fit and facilitates both press-on application and rotational removal, enhancing the overall usability of the container.
